1. Understanding the SQA Year 8 Chinese Exam Format | 了解 SQA 8 年级中文考试形式

The SQA Year 8 Chinese qualification is usually mapped to SCQF Level 3 or a preparatory stage for National 3/4 Modern Languages. Past papers typically consist of two components: Understanding Language (which combines listening and reading) and Using Language (which focuses on writing and speaking). The listening section often uses short dialogues or announcements, while the reading part involves signs, messages, and short paragraphs. The writing tasks require learners to produce phrases and simple sentences, and the speaking assessment is conducted through role-plays and brief presentations.

2. Listening Comprehension: Key Skills from Past Papers | 听力理解:历年真题关键技巧

Listening questions in Year 8 SQA Chinese past papers are designed to test your ability to pick out specific details and follow the gist of short spoken texts. A typical question plays a recording twice: first to get the general idea, second to confirm your answers. Topics are drawn from everyday life, such as buying train tickets, talking about weekend plans, or describing a family photo. The exam often asks you to tick boxes, complete a table, or write one-word answers.

From past papers we notice that distractors are used cleverly. For instance, a dialogue might mention ‘seven o’clock’, ‘half past seven’, and ‘eight o’clock’, but only one is the correct meeting time. To choose right, you must listen for the exact question word – ‘what time will they actually meet?’ – and ignore the other times that appear in the conversation. Always read the question before the audio starts and underline keywords like ‘who’, ‘where’, ‘when’, and ‘how much’.

Another crucial skill is distinguishing tones, because two words with different meanings may sound similar to a beginner. Past papers frequently test minimal pairs like ma (mother) and ma (horse) or shuìjiào (sleep) and shuǐjiǎo (dumpling). A good revision technique is to listen to past recordings while reading the transcripts and mark the tones you hear.

A common pitfall in writing is confusing 的, 得, and 地. Past papers repeatedly show candidates losing marks for using 的 instead of 得 in complement structures like ‘跑得很快’ (runs fast). Always check whether what follows is a noun, a complement, or an adverbial phrase. Practise by correcting sentences from older exam scripts – this is one of the fastest ways to eliminate your own mistakes.

Past exam board samples reveal that high-scoring candidates do not just give one-word replies; they extend their answers with 因为 (because) or 但是 (but). For example, when asked ‘你喜欢什么运动?’, a basic answer ‘篮球’ will earn a pass, but ‘我喜欢打篮球, 因为很好玩也很健康’ can push the score into the highest band. Therefore, always prepare two or three reasons for each common topic.

6. Grammar Patterns Seen in Exams | 考试中出现的语法结构

Grammar is not tested explicitly, but your use of it underpins every mark. By studying past papers, we can identify several structures that appear again and again: the 是……的 construction for emphasis, comparative sentences with 比, the aspect particle 了 for completed actions, and the location marker 在. These are often embedded inside reading texts and must be used accurately in writing and speaking.

Past marking feedback points out that many candidates omit the second 的 in the 是……的 pattern when referring to past events, such as saying ‘我是去年开始学中文’ instead of the correct ‘我是去年开始学中文的’. A useful exercise is to go through old reading passages and highlight every 是……的 sentence, then write two similar sentences about your own experiences.

Another area of frequent grammatical difficulty is the placement of time expressions. Chinese normally places time words before the verb, but learners influenced by English often put them at the end. Past paper writing tasks show errors like ‘我吃饭在七点’ instead of ‘我七点吃饭’. Reading model answers from examiner reports helps you internalise the correct order.

Memorising these words in isolation is not enough. Past papers show that the same word often appears in multiple contexts. The word ‘点’, for instance, can be a measure word (一点), a time unit (七点), or part of a request (点菜). Always learn vocabulary in the form of exam-style phrases, not just single dictionary entries.

9. Common Mistakes and Examiner Tips | 常见错误与考官建议

Examiners’ reports from previous years are exceptionally valuable because they highlight the same mistakes that appear year after year. The top five errors are: using the wrong measure word (e.g., 一本书 becomes 一个书), confusion between 二 and 两 (两 is used before measure words), incorrect tone marks in Pinyin, forgetting the measure word altogether, and writing characters with missing or extra strokes.

10. Effective Revision Strategies Using Past Papers | 使用历年真题的有效复习策略

Past papers should be more than just test practice; they are a revision blueprint. Start by taking one full paper under timed conditions to identify your weak spots. Then, rather than immediately moving to the next paper, spend a session dissecting every mistake. Did you lose marks on tone recognition? Then dedicate 20 minutes a day to minimal pair drills. Did you mess up the writing prompt? Then rewrite your answer using the model structure from the marking guidelines.
